For example to list jobs scheduled for current user. Gnome gui for configuring a users cron automatic jobs. This tool can be very useful for beginners because it autocalculates the timing options and translates them in a humanreadable way, thus. Type which octave to see where is the octave version you want to run and fix your paths. How to configure cron jobs on redhat enterprise linux. December 02, 2012 7 comments whenever i try to explain using cron to schedule jobs, new linux users cringe at the thought of learning yet another command line tool. Aug 23, 2018 the noobs may unknowingly do small mistakes while editing plain text crontab and bring down all cron jobs. If the users crontab file is empty then crontab l exits with status 1. The e option allows you to edit your cron file or create a cron file does not exist.
How to install crontabui for remote use techrepublic. But today i found one of my centos servers doesnt have this command. It is used to schedule commands or scripts to run periodically and at fixed intervals. Jan 30, 2015 for example, you can easily label and organize your cron type jobs, manage a network of computers and your users crontab files, beck up easily, and version control your cron type jobs. Gnomeschedule also supports titles and icons for your tasks so.
If youre looking for a fancier way of doing things, you can also setup your cron jobs with crontab. How to install task scheduler gui tool for crontab. The crontab is used for running specific tasks on a regular interval. Crontab guru schedule cron jobs quickly and easily. Dec 02, 2019 npm install g crontab ui crontab ui if you need to setuse an alternative host or port, you may do so by setting an environment variable before starting the process. Cron is one of the most powerful tool in a linux unix based operating systems. July 18, 2014 cron crontab debian hacks learnshell linux raspberrypi tricks. Crontab is very useful for routine tasks like scheduling system scanning, daily backups etc.
Tasks range from backing up the users home folders every day at midnight, to logging cpu information every hour. If the u option is given, it specifies the name of the user. As we can see from the last line of the above code snippet, we did setup a system autoreboot on every sunday at 00. Just in case, if you think you might mess up with your cron jobs, there is a good alternative way. A cron job is a linux utility used for scheduling a task to be executed in the specific time according to its schedule at designated time. Scheduling tasks with cron raspberry pi documentation. Linux and unixlike operating system may change the default from varspoolcron to something else. It works well fully optimized on mobile devices you can generate cron syntax on. The script is designed to work with the users environment, respectively the cron jobs shall be set within users crontab file. Schedule cron jobs with this easy to use gui by jack wallen on march 09, 2011 in linux last update. Note that cron in this directory should not be accessed directly the crontab command should be used to access and update them as follows. Scheduling tasks with cron means programs can run but you dont have to.
Its website has a schedule generator whose variables minute, hour, day of the month, day of the week, month, etc. If you are a user and want to see your crontab you can just give crontab l example3. Whenever i try to explain using cron to schedule jobs, new linux users cringe at the thought of learning. The only drawback is that it has not been updated since 2010. If you scheduled the task for 6pm, then your lights will come on no earlier than 6pm. Apr 25, 2018 in other words, all those gui less linux servers can benefit from this as well. Rhel centos linux ftp cron job for automatic ftp backup. It supports periodical tasks and tasks that happens once in the future. Crontab is the program used to install, deinstall or list the tables used to drive the cron daemon in vixie cron. To edit crontab entries use the following command which will open up the crontab editor in vi the default text editor.
Below the generated crontab syntax, a list of run times will be displayed too. The cron utility runs based on commands specified in a cron table crontab. Gnome scheduler can easily be installed in linux mint 18. Sounds like a roots crontab is initially empty and b the e option is set in the shell.
Linux crontab is similar to windows task schedules. This project is a fork from the work by dan risacher. Crontab executes jobs automatically in the backend at a. To view jobs scheduled under other user specify username with a switch like below. Cron is a tool for configuring scheduled tasks on unix systems. Export crontab and deploy on other machines without much hassle. Here is the list of top 10 linux distributions to free download latest version of linux operating system with links to linux documentation and home pages. Cronitor is easy to integrate and provides you with instant alerts when things go wrong. This article will cover using the cron directories and using crontab. Crontab is very useful for routine tasks like scheduling system scanning, daily backups, etc. This is something i made to allow easy and safe management of crontab. If shell is running with e option then it will exit immediately on failure defined as exiting with nonzero status.
Schedule cron jobs with this easy to use gui ghacks tech. Next, run the following command to install crontab ui. I have tried to install this using yum install crontab but no luck. If the job is no longer required, simply press delete button.
How to edit the linux crontab file to schedule jobs. The author is the creator of nixcraft and a seasoned sysadmin, devops engineer, and a trainer for the linux operating systemunix shell scripting. Corntab is a simple and quick crontab gui to help translate crontab syntax. Each user can have their own crontab, and though these are files in var, they are not intended to be edited directly. How to configure crontab in linux the linux juggernaut. I am familiar to setup the cron scheduler using crontab e command on my centos. Crontab guru is a free editor for both beginner and advanced users to edit and schedule cron jobs in a quick and easy manner you can use crontab to create cron schedule expressions for almost anytime period you can imagine.
Crontab executes jobs automatically in the backend on a specified time and interval. A crontab file contains instructions to the cron8 daemon of the general form. Cron is one of the most powerful tool in a linuxunix based operating systems. Humanreadable strings like every hour instead of 0.
These files dont exist by default, but can be created in the varspoolcron directory using the crontab e command thats also used to edit a cron file see the script. This project is dedicated to developing a win32 system service that provides unistyle cron. I use corntab all the time to schedule cron jobs for my linux servers on a2. For example, you can easily label and organize your cron type jobs, manage a network of computers and your users crontab files, beck up easily, and version control your cron type jobs. Setting up a cron job to download a file daily digitalocean. How to easily and safely manage cron jobs in linux ostechnix. Crongiulauncher is a simple bash script, that is able to launch a gui application as cron job within ubuntu. I need to download a file each day at 8am est from a server. Crontab in linux with 20 useful examples to schedule jobs. Then i tried yum install crontabs and it installed something. The suns position is calculated using time, and position latitude and longitude should be specified on the command line.
It provides outofthebox solution and include browser,media supports java and lots of other components. This article provides information on how to configure cron jobs on redhat enterprise linux rhel 6. How do i go about setting this up for my developer im reading that crontab is how i do this. One in usrbinoctave an older version without the forcegui option, and a new version that is in your path but not on the path when cron runs. One in usrbinoctave an older version without the force gui option, and a new version that is in your path but not on the path when cron runs. If run as root, you can edit any users crontab and at tasks. The quick and simple editor for cron schedule expressions by cronitor. Gnomeschedule also supports titles and icons for your tasks so that they are more easily to keep track of. Want to install crontab gui task scheduler for linux redhat 7. Crontab gui is a great and the original online crontab editor.
Use this command to install crontab, start the cron daemon, and turn it on at startup. Oct 01, 20 to list the job scheduler under crontab, we can use l command line switch with crontab command. A cron job is a linux utility used for scheduling a task to be executed in the specific. Cron is the scheduling system for linux and without it youd be hardpressed to schedule regular tasks on linux. With crontab ui, it is very easy to manage crontab. Get the latest tutorials on sysadmin, linuxunix and open source topics via rssxml feed or weekly email newsletter. We created cronitor because cron itself cant alert you if your jobs fail or never start. Automating tasks on ubuntu can be done through a package called cron.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ration.
Crontab is an abbreviation for cron table and is a configuration file used to schedule shell commands to run periodically. Mar 11, 2020 the crontab is used for running specific tasks on a regular interval. Say hello to crontab ui, a webbased tool to easily and safely manage cron jobs in unixlike operating systems. Only system administrators with root privileges can edit the crontab file. Crontab or cron web interface or gui tools email protected email protected helps desktop users to easily design cron and at jobs.
This can be achieved in two ways 1removing all the crontab entries for a particular user. If you are not that afraid of command line, you can install gnome schedule with. Cron jobs allow system administrators to schedule tasks. It is designed to let power users implement their own type of tasks for scheduling. Jul 20, 2007 gnomeschedule is a grapichal user interface to crontab and at, both used to schedule tasks. This is made possible through a plugin approach and a strong api for coding new task types. Each user has their own crontab, and commands in any given crontab will be executed as the user who owns the crontab. Gnomeschedule is a grapichal user interface to crontab and at, both used to schedule tasks. This gu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. Usually, the crontab file is stored in the etc or a directory under etc.
Schedule cron jobs with this easy to use gui ghacks tech news. Im going to walk you through the process of installing crontab ui and how to use it from a different machine. How to configure cron jobs on redhat enterprise linux rhel. Templates support so that you wont have to create the same task again and again. Apr 15, 20 download cronw cron for windows for free. How to install cron crond, crontab linux tips, hacks. If you wanted to change any parameter in a cron job, just click on the edit button below a cron job and modify the parameters as you wish to run a job immediately, click on the button that says run. There are various ways you can configure these scheduled tasks. You can view the log details of any job by clicking on the log button. With the help of a userfriendly gui, you too can have cron scheduling automatic jobs for you.
1023 1564 234 911 840 903 232 7 1019 374 407 1309 572 581 1180 245 959 1049 831 805 494 164 371 688 1488 762 1052 1204 1450 412 233 352 1005 573 695